  1. Scientific activity status Background and purpose The MoBa Study has216 subprojects, of which 149 are active. Of these ,12 sub-studies have additional data collection and 6 sub-studies have linkages to external registries. Two of the large projects are: The Autism Birth Cohort (ABC) Study is a collaboration between the Norwegian Institute of Public Health, Columbia University and NIH/NINDS. The ADHD Study is a collaboration between NIPH and Oslo University Hospital. MoBa is a nationwide population-based pregnancy cohort study. Recruitment started in one county in 1999, and was gradually stepped up to include all parts of Norway from 2005-2008. The aim of the study is to elucidate the aetiology and pathogenesis of disorders that may originate in early life. Material and methods Pregnant women and their partners were recruited in connection with their routine hospital ultrasound examination at week 17-19 of pregnancy. 50 hospitals in Norway participated in the study. Participation is based on informed consent. Mothers are asked to complete 3 questionnaires during pregnancy and again when the child is 6, 18 and 36 months, and further at 5, 7 and 8 years. Fathers are asked to complete one questionnaire during pregnancy. The data are linked to the Medical Birth Registry of Norway (MBRN) for pregnancy-outcome data and other information related to pregnancy. Blood samples are collected from the mother (prenatal and at birth), the father and the child (cord blood). Urine samples are collected from the mother (prenatal). DNA, RNA, whole blood, plasma and urine are aliquoted and stored at -20ºC and -80ºC, respectively. Milk teeth are collected when the child is about 7 years old. Publication status • 116 publications • 60 submitted publications • 14 Doctoral theses (PhD) • 9 Theses of Master of Science Cancer cases – status December 2009 Through linkage to the Cancer Registry we have identified all children in MoBa who received a cancer diagnosis per December 31, 2009. In totalthere are 106 cases. 41 are cases of leukemia (80 % ALL, 20 % AML). We have alsoidentified 36 cases of cancer ofthebrain/nervous system.
